For tiny buildings, including properties, which are only two or three stories significant, demolition is really a instead uncomplicated system. The making is pulled down either manually or mechanically using big hydraulic equipment: elevated get the job done platforms, cranes, excavators or bulldozers. More substantial structures may well need the use of a wrecking ball, a heavy excess weight over a cable which is swung by a crane into the aspect with the buildings.

e. prior to demolition begins) to provide principal contractors just as much information and facts as you can to allow the principal contractor to keep folks (internet site workers and the public) as far as you can from your risks.

Large attain demolition excavators tend to be more generally employed for tall structures where by explosive demolition just isn't acceptable or doable. Excavators with shear attachments are usually accustomed to dismantle steel structural features. Hydraulic hammers tend to be useful for concrete structures and concrete processing attachments are accustomed to crush concrete into a workable dimensions, and to remove reinforcing steel.
